6 \section{Types of \MTA{}s}
7 ``Mail transfer agent'' is a term covering a variety of programs. One thing is common to them: they transport email from one \emph{thing} to another. These \emph{things} can be hosts, meaning independent machines, or protocols like \NAME{SMTP} and \NAME{UUCP}, between which mail is transfered.\footnote{\sendmail{}'s initial purpose was moving mail between \NAME{UUCP}, \name{Berknet} and \NAME{SMTP}.}
9 Beside this common property, \MTA{}s can be very different. Some of them have \NAME{POP3} and/or \NAME{IMAP} servers included. Some can fetch mails through these protocols. Others have have every feature you can think of. And maybe there are some that do nothing else, but transporting email.
12 \section{The ones not regarded here}
13 The candidates for the competition in the next chapter are a subset of the \MTA{}s available. Comparision between totally different programs (apart of one function) makes not much sense. One would not use a program for a job it is not suited for. Therefor \mta{}s that are rarely similar to \masqmail\ are not regarded.
15 The first group of programs to sort out are the so called \name{groupware} programs. These provide a whole lot of functions, including mail transfer, file storage, calendars, resource management, instant messaging and more.
16 Examples for this kind of programs are: \name{Lotus Notes}, \name{Microsoft Exchange}, \name{OpenGroupware.org} and \name{eGroupWare}.
18 The second group are the \name{relay-only} \MTA{}s.
19 They transfer mail only to defined \name{smart hosts}\index{smart host}\footnote{MTAs that receives email and route it to the actual destination}. Most \MTA{}s can be configured to act as such a forwarder. But this is normally an additional functionality.
20 Examples for that group are: \name{nullmailer}, \name{ssmtp} and \name{esmtp}.

50 \subsection{\masqmail}
51 The \masqmail\ program was written by Oliver Kurth, starting in 1999. His aim was to create a \mta\ which is especially focused on computers with dial-up connections to the internet. \masqmail\ handles situations which are rarely solveable with the common \MTA{}s.
